[Jae-sung Kim's Negotiation Practice - Utilizing MESO in Real-world Negotiations]
Hello, today I received a proposal to create new online content. There were no major issues with the other details, but in order to get better terms, I tried negotiating once again!
Company A (Client) Proposal: OOO won paid as a lump sum
My proposal
1. Lump-sum payment: Requested 2.5 times the original proposal
2. Revenue Share Payment (Presented two options)
2.1. Partial lump-sum payment (1/2 of the original proposal) + a certain percentage of RS
2.2. No lump-sum payment + a certain percentage of RS (a rate 50% higher than option 2.1.)
Those who haven't taken a negotiation course would likely try to negotiate for a higher amount when they feel the initial offer is too low, or depending on the situation, they might end up accepting the proposal reluctantly.
In my case, I already had a history of collaborating with this client multiple times, and the RS (Revenue Share) terms I proposed were at the same percentage level as those previously agreed upon, so
I stated, "I am proposing an RS (Revenue Share) plan based on our past history and for the sake of a long-term partnership."
Meanwhile, the initial amount proposed by the client was at a similar level to what is typically offered for similar content production. By proposing an option 2.5 times higher than that, I threw out a choice in advance so that they would avoid choosing Option 1 if possible. However, even if they were to choose the 2.5x option, I would have no major complaints. (This specific point is related to MESO, which you can learn about in the course.)
